Meijer, Dark Chocolate Covered Cashews - 230 calories
Manufacturer Meijer, Inc.
Product Information and Ingredients
Meijer, Dark Chocolate Covered Cashews is manufactured by Meijer, Inc. with a suggested serving size of 13 PIECES (40 g) and 230 calories per serving. The nutritional value of a suggested serving of meijer, dark chocolate covered cashews includes 5 mg of cholesterol, 0 mg of sodium, 20 grams of carbohydrates, 3 grams of dietary fiber, 15 grams of sugar and 5 grams of proteins.
The product's manufacturer code is UPC: 713733254229.
This product is high in sugars and saturated fats.
Calories from fat: a total of 62.61% of the total calories in this suggested serving come from fat. Try to consume less than 10 percent of daily calories from saturated fats.
Sugars 24% of DV
A serving of 13 PIECES (40 g) of meijer, dark chocolate covered cashews has 24% of the recommended daily intake of sugars.
Saturated Fats 14% of DV
A serving of 13 PIECES (40 g) of meijer, dark chocolate covered cashews has 14% of the recommended daily intake of saturated fats.
Ingredient List
- Dark Chocolate (sugar
- Chocolate Liquor [processed With Alkali]
- Cocoa Butter
- Milk Fat
- Soy Lecithin [an Emulsifier]
- Vanilla)
- Cashews
- Canola Oil
- Corn Syrup
- Modified Starch (tapioca)
- Confectioner's Glaze

Dietary Recommendations
A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:
-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
- A variety of whole fruits
-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
-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
-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
-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
